The Pan-African Student Recognition Ceremony is an annual celebration that honors our Pan-African graduates for their achievements.
|
Below are the details for this event:
-
Students who participate will receive a kente sash, a commemorative booklet containing short biographical statements of the graduate candidates, and a participation certificate.
